Technical Indicators Signal Bullish Momentum
The primary catalyst for the rating upgrade stems from a marked improvement in the technical grade, which shifted from mildly bullish to bullish. Key momentum indicators such as the Moving Average Convergence Divergence (MACD) are bullish on both weekly and monthly charts, signalling sustained upward momentum. The daily moving averages also support this positive trend, reinforcing the stock’s short-term strength.
Bollinger Bands have transitioned from mildly bullish on the weekly timeframe to bullish on the monthly, indicating increasing volatility in favour of price appreciation. The Know Sure Thing (KST) oscillator confirms this bullish stance on both weekly and monthly scales, while the On-Balance Volume (OBV) indicator shows a bullish trend monthly, suggesting accumulation by investors.
Despite a mildly bearish signal from the Dow Theory on the weekly chart and neutral readings from the Relative Strength Index (RSI), the overall technical picture is decidedly positive. The stock’s price has demonstrated resilience, trading near ₹1,422.75 with intraday highs touching ₹1,468.00, well above its 52-week low of ₹817.20 and approaching the 52-week high of ₹1,509.15.
Financial Trend Reflects Strong Operational Performance
GE Shipping Co’s financial performance in Q3 FY25-26 has been a key driver of the upgrade. The company reported its highest quarterly net sales at ₹1,454.44 crores, underscoring robust demand and operational efficiency. Operating profit to interest coverage ratio reached an impressive 33.49 times, highlighting the company’s strong ability to service debt and maintain financial stability.
Management efficiency remains high, with a return on equity (ROE) of 16.12%, signalling effective utilisation of shareholder capital. The company’s debt-to-equity ratio remains exceptionally low at an average of 0.02 times, with a half-yearly low of 0.08 times, reflecting a conservative capital structure that minimises financial risk.
Institutional investors hold a significant 43.69% stake in the company, having increased their holdings by 1.78% over the previous quarter. This institutional confidence often correlates with strong fundamental backing and suggests that well-informed investors are bullish on the stock’s prospects.

Quality Metrics Remain Robust Amidst Sector Leadership
GE Shipping Co stands as the largest company in the transport services sector with a market capitalisation of ₹20,381 crores, representing 44.08% of the sector’s total market cap. Its annual sales of ₹5,120.73 crores account for 39.38% of the industry, underscoring its dominant position.
The company’s quality grade is supported by its consistent management efficiency and conservative leverage. The low debt-to-equity ratio and high operating profit to interest coverage ratio reflect prudent financial management and operational resilience. These factors contribute to the company’s Mojo Score of 72.0 and a current Mojo Grade of Buy, upgraded from Hold.
Valuation: Premium but Justified by Performance
While the stock trades at a premium valuation with a price-to-book ratio of 1.3 times, this is reflective of its superior market position and financial health. The company’s return on equity of 13.4% remains attractive, though investors should note that profits have declined by 21.7% over the past year despite the stock generating a 62.06% return in the same period.
This divergence suggests that the market is pricing in future growth and operational improvements, supported by the company’s strong technical momentum and institutional backing. However, the premium valuation warrants cautious monitoring, particularly in the context of sector and macroeconomic conditions.
Market-Beating Returns Reinforce Upgrade
GE Shipping Co has delivered exceptional returns relative to the broader market benchmarks. Over the past year, the stock has generated a 62.06% return compared to a near flat return of -0.04% for the Sensex. Over longer horizons, the outperformance is even more pronounced, with 119.64% returns over three years versus 31.67% for the Sensex, and a staggering 394.18% over five years compared to 64.59% for the benchmark.
These returns highlight the company’s ability to create shareholder value consistently, supported by strong fundamentals and positive technical trends. The stock’s resilience and growth trajectory justify the upgrade to a Buy rating, signalling confidence in its near- and long-term prospects.

Risks and Considerations
Despite the positive outlook, investors should be mindful of certain risks. The company’s profits have declined by 21.7% over the past year, which could indicate margin pressures or cyclical challenges in the shipping industry. Additionally, the premium valuation relative to peers means that any slowdown in growth or adverse sector developments could impact the stock’s performance.
Furthermore, while technical indicators are currently bullish, the mildly bearish Dow Theory signal on the weekly chart suggests some caution in the short term. Investors should monitor upcoming quarterly results and sector dynamics closely to validate the sustainability of the current momentum.
Conclusion: Upgrade Reflects Balanced Optimism
The upgrade of Great Eastern Shipping Company Ltd from Hold to Buy by MarketsMOJO is a reflection of its improved technical outlook, strong financial performance, and dominant market position. The company’s robust quarterly results, high management efficiency, and institutional investor confidence underpin this positive revision.
While valuation remains on the higher side and profit declines warrant attention, the stock’s market-beating returns and bullish technical signals provide a compelling case for investors seeking exposure to the transport services sector. The upgrade signals a favourable risk-reward profile, making GE Shipping Co a stock to watch in the coming quarters.
